The Scott City Police Department is looking for qualified applicants for a position as a law enforcement officer. Must have high school diploma or equivalent, Missouri POST License, be over the age of 21, and live within a 30 minute response time. Application process includes an interview, background investigation, and drug screen. Starting pay is 15 dollars an hour upon hiring, which increases to 16 dollars an hour upon completion of the FTO process. With the wet and cold weather upon us the Scott City Police Department would like to remind its residents and those traveling during this busy time of year to practice extra vigilance while operating a motor vehicle. Inclement weather and distracted driving are a common cause of motor vehicle accidents. As the construction continues on the Route 61 overpass, I-55 interchange, and Route M intersection please be aware of and practice caution within work zones. Maintain a safe... distance between you and the car in front of you. Limit unnecessary distractions, such as cell phones and other electronic devices. Adhere to the speed limit and slow down while the roads are wet or icy. Be aware of pedestrians and other vehicles around you. Check your surroundings before making lane changes or turns. See more

As many of you will be out taking advantage of the Black Friday deals and the gift giving season right around the corner, the Scott City Police Department would like to remind the Scott City residents of the importance of record keeping for purchased items or items received as a gift. Almost every item you purchase contains identifying features such as brand, make, model, and serial numbers. In the case of jewelry, photographs or a record of the type of gem, style of cut, and... metal type can be retained. This information is something of value the citizens can provide in efforts to assist the police department in recovering their property in the unfortunate event a theft occurs. So remember... keep receipts, write down or photograph make, model and serial numbers because it helps us help you. A friendly reminder from: Detective Cavaness Scott City Police Department
